John AXON, GC (Posthumously)

No. & Rank at the Time of Action: Locomotive Driver
Unit/Occupation: British Rail
Date and Place of Birth: 4th December 1900, 38 Providence Street, Stockport, Cheshire
Family: Husband of Gladys
Early Life: He joined the Railway service at the end of the great war when he became an engine cleaner at Longsight, Manchester.
Date and Place of GC Action: 9th February 1957, Chapel-en-le-Frith, Derbyshire
The London Gazette: 7th May 1957
